The Clinical Pharmacist Specialist plays a pivotal role in optimizing patient care by collaborating with healthcare professionals to ensure the safe and effective use of medications. As a member of our pharmacy team, you will provide specialized pharmaceutical services, conduct medication reviews, and contribute to the development and implementation of clinical protocols and guidelines.
What you will do- Assess the medication needs of patients and develop individualized treatment plans.
- Monitor and review medication orders for accuracy and appropriateness.
- Provide medication counseling to patients and their caregivers.
- Work closely with physicians, nurses, and other healthcare providers to optimize medication therapy and outcomes.
- Offer drug information and recommendations to healthcare professionals.
- Assist in the development and implementation of evidence-based clinical protocols and guidelines.
- Collaborate in research and quality improvement projects related to pharmaceutical care.
- Identify and report medication errors and adverse drug events.
- Stay current with developments in pharmacy practice and contribute to the professional growth of the department.
- Ensure compliance with federal and state pharmacy laws and regulations.
- Maintain accurate and complete records of all pharmaceutical activities.
- Doctorate Pharmacy required
- PHD Pharmacy required
- Completion of a pharmacy residency program or equivalent experience preferred.
